BLUE RING Machine taps for blind holes (set of 14 pcs.) incl. drills DIN 371/376 M 3 – M 12
The BLUE RING machine tap set for blind holes, DIN 371/376, HSS-E, M3–M12 is designed for demanding applications in wear resistant steels up to 1200 N/mm². Thanks to the Form C 39° RSP spiral flute geometry, the taps are optimised for reliable chip evacuation in blind holes, especially in high alloy steels, short-chipping materials, short-chipping stainless steels and alloy tool steels. The set includes the matching twist drills for each thread size.

Step-by-step tapping guide
- Drill the core hole: Use the appropriate twist drill from the set (2.5 / 3.3 / 4.2 / 5.0 / 6.8 / 8.5 / 10.2 mm).
- Chamfer the entry: A light chamfer helps to centre the tap and improves the thread start.
- Clamp the tool: Securely clamp the tap in a suitable collet, chuck or quick-change system.
- Set cutting parameters: Choose suitable cutting speed and feed for the material and coolant used.
- Tap the thread: Tap with continuous feed, ensuring correct alignment and sufficient lubrication.
- Retract the tap: Carefully reverse out of the blind hole without jerky movements.
- Check the thread: Inspect with a matching screw or thread gauge.

FAQ – Frequently asked questions
Are these taps suitable for stainless steel?
Yes, they are designed for short-chipping stainless steels and other difficult materials.
Why a 39° spiral flute?
The 39° helix is optimised for chip evacuation from blind holes in tough, short-chipping materials.
Can I also use them in through holes?
Possible, but for through holes a straight flute or Form B tap is often more efficient.
Are the correct drill sizes included?
Yes, all required core hole twist drills from 2.5 mm to 10.2 mm are included.
Is coolant necessary?
Yes, we strongly recommend suitable cutting oil or coolant, especially in high alloy and wear resistant steels.
